Justice Minister Akın Gürlek, who was appointed by President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an, made statements during a television program he attended. Speaking on A Haber live broadcast, Gürlek answered questions from journalists.
A LOJ JUSTICE LINE IS BEING ESTABLISHED
Akın Gürlek announced that a Justice Line will be established during the live broadcast. Gürlek stated regarding the details of the line, "It will be like CIMER. Currently, Turkey's biggest problem is the delays in lawsuit processes. Citizens are very victimized in this regard."
"WE WILL SOLVE THE VICTIMIZATIONS AS SOON AS POSSIBLE"
Stating, "For example, a divorce case has not been concluded for 17 hearings, or a rental case is ongoing for 8 hearings," Gürlek said, "They will call the line. We hope to solve the victimizations in the judiciary as soon as possible."
